WebAug 12, 2016 · First perforated 2d blue stamp. Official perforations came into use on Great Britain’s postage stamps on Jan. 31, 1854. Scott 13: perf 14, watermark small crown (1855) Perforation gauge is 14. Two horizontal white lines, at the top and at the bottom of Victoria’s head. Watermark small crown.
